Understanding the Crash Game Mechanics
At its heart, the crash game is built on a provably fair system, meaning the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ic algorithm that is transparent and verifiable. This ensures that the game isn't rigged and that players have a reasonable assurance of fairness. Each round begins with a multiplier starting at 1x. This multiplier gradually increases over time, offering increasingly larger potential payouts. The game employs a random number generator (RNG) to determine the point at which the multiplier will ‘crash.’ What sets this apart from traditional casino games is the player’s direct involvement in determining the payout.
Unlike slots or roulette where chance dictates the outcome, in a crash game, you decide when to collect your winnings. Cashing out early secures a smaller profit, but guarantees a return. Waiting for a higher multiplier offers the potential for a significant win, but carries the risk of losing your entire stake if the multiplier crashes before you cash out. This dynamic creates a constant internal struggle between greed and caution. Many platforms also offer features like auto-cashout, allowing you to pre-set a multiplier at which your bet will automatically be settled, reducing the pressure and enabling a more relaxed playing style.
Key Terms to Know
Familiarizing yourself with the common terminology used in crash games is crucial for understanding strategy discussions and optimizing your gameplay. The ‘multiplier’ is the central element, indicating the potential return on your bet. ‘Cashing out’ refers to claiming your winnings before the crash, while ‘busting’ means the multiplier crashed before you cashed out, resulting in a loss. ‘Provably fair’ denotes the transparency and verifiability of the game’s outcome. The ‘RNG’ or random number generator is the software that determines when the crash will occur. Understanding these terms forms the foundation for enjoying and navigating the game effectively.
Beyond these core terms, you might encounter phrases like ‘auto-cashout,’ which, as mentioned, pre-sets a withdrawal point. Some games also feature functions like ‘double cashout,’ which allows players to cash out twice during a single round. It’s important to read the specific rules and terminology of the platform you're playing on, before placing any actual bets. A thorough understanding of these elements will place you in a much more informed and advantageous position.
| Term | Definition |
|---|---|
| Multiplier | The factor by which your bet is multiplied if you cash out before the crash. |
| Cash Out | Claiming your winnings before the multiplier crashes. |
| Bust | The multiplier crashes before you cash out, resulting in a loss of your stake. |
| Provably Fair | A system ensuring game outcomes are transparent and verifiable. |

The Importance of Bankroll Management
Regardless of the strategy you choose, effective bankroll management is absolutely crucial. This involves setting a budget for your gambling session and sticking to it, regardless of whether you are winning or losing. It’s advisable to only bet a small percentage of your bankroll on each round, typically between 1% and 5%. This prevents you from depleting your funds too quickly and ensures that you have enough capital to weather losing streaks. Treat crash games as a form of entertainment, not a source of income, and never chase your losses. A disciplined approach to bankroll management is the cornerstone of sustainable and enjoyable gameplay.
Furthermore, consider setting win and loss limits. If you reach your predetermined win limit, cash out your profits and walk away. Similarly, if you reach your loss limit, stop playing and avoid the temptation to recoup your losses. This helps to prevent emotional decision-making and ensures you maintain control of your finances. A well-managed bankroll is the difference between a fun experience and a costly one.

The Psychological Aspects of Crash Games
Crash games are as much a psychological challenge as they are a game of chance. The rapid pace and the allure of potentially large payouts can lead to impulsive decision-making and emotional betting. The fear of missing out (FOMO) – the desire to cash out at a higher multiplier – often drives players to take unnecessary risks. Recognizing these psychological tendencies is crucial for maintaining control and making rational decisions. It’s important to remain calm and objective, even during periods of excitement or frustration. Avoid letting emotions cloud your judgment, and stick to your pre-determined strategy.
The adrenaline rush associated with watching the multiplier climb can be incredibly addictive, and it’s easy to get caught up in the moment. Taking regular breaks can help you to step back, regain perspective, and avoid making impulsive bets. It’s also helpful to practice mindfulness and focus on the present moment, rather than dwelling on past losses or fantasizing about future wins. Remember that the game is designed to be entertaining, and it’s important to prioritize enjoyment over the pursuit of profit. Understanding the psychological factors at play is vital for responsible gaming.
